Bookkeeping Equation

The bookkeeping equation for a sole business is assets = liabilities + owner’s equity. The bookkeeping equation for a corporation is assets = liabilities + stockholder’s equity. The bookkeeping equation is also known as the accounting equation.

In this bookkeeping equation, here are the main elements:

  • The resources owned by the business are known as assets
  • The amounts that are owed by the business are known as liabilities
  • The amount invested by the owner along with the net income of the business subtraction the amounts withdrawn by the owner for personal use are known as owner’s equity
